A cloudburst of effervescence aided by the familiar vocal choruses almost entirely instantaneous in its appeal whilst concealing depth on repeated playings. This I feel categorically ridicules the stateside bemoaning of melancholy underpinned by jealousy no doubt. Amongst the number of highs my personal choice is "Don't Let It Break Your Heart" a track which was unfortunately missing from their playlist at The O2 last night. This collection has the potential to connect to a wider audience yet suspect alienate fans from the early years of "Parachutes" and "A Rush Of Blood To The Head." Their intention to restrict the playlist of this album is however a mistake as existing tracks could have matured further complimented by tracks left in the vaults of the recording studio.The tracks used as singles to date are audience pleasers as their distinctive sound evokes a natural progression from 2008. The question is, is this the last studio outing?Read full review
First of all, I am a die hard Coldplay fan, and have been for many years. So don't think that my low rating is just me being ignorant, it's the truth. I started listening to coldplay back in 2006. When Viva La Vida or Death And All His Friends came out, it was their best work yet. The album was amazing, based on the french revolution, and making the hit song known all around the world "Viva La Vida". Also, Lovers in Japan, another one of their hits, is a song that talks about hope, to keep moving forward, and seeing people moving on. This is my favorite album to date. The new album "Mylo Xyloto" was a huge disappointment. It took them over 3 years to do it, and it sucks. With an exception of 2 songs on the album, the last 2 tracks. Coldplay have very much lost their sound. This new album is more pop then actual music, and more computer generated sounds, then actual instruments. I had built up so much hope for the new album, and it was destroyed when I heard it. I don't get why the song "charlie brown" was such a hit. It's a stupid song, with even a silly title. Princess of china is the worst song the band has done to date. Mainly because of Rhianna; she destroyed the song. This is why the band has become more "Pop" then actual music. In the song princess of china, rhianna sings more then Chris does! It is such a horrible song, with crappy noises. There are 3 tiny little tracks between the songs, which are just pretty much computer generated sounds of tracks already on the album. The band played more then half the album live for months, before the album even came out! There was no surprise, and that's what really killed the album. We all knew what the album was going to sound like. In my opinion, don't waste your money on the album, unless you like pop music or rap. I no longer have any hope for the band.Read full review
I think this is a fine CD and has a tremendous amount of variety of style which was a good breakthrough for Coldplay. Rush of Blood to the Head, X&Y, and Parachutes are better because they lack the occasional annoying song that you just must forward past as happens on some other Coldplay CD's. If you are new to Coldplay, I would recommend Rush of Blood to the Head or X&Y. If you choose this CD you'll love some songs, feel ok about others, but probably have several that will start annoying you after a short time so that you'll want to forward through them. Still, no Coldplay collection would be complete without Mylo Xyloto.
Pretty good CD/Album, but not Coldplay's best.
